G404. Summary of Test Method4.1 This test method can be used to measure the frict
18、ioncharacteristics of a flexible web as it slides on a cylindricalsurface. The web conforms to the cylindrical surface in the areaof wrap.4.2 The test method is conducted on a narrow web or striptaken from a web of interest. One end of the strip is drapedover a stationary cylinder and the other end
19、is affixed to a forcemeasuring device. A mass is applied to the free end of the stripand the strip is pulled by a mechanism that moves the forcetransducer perpendicular to the long axis of the cylindricalsurface. The force encountered in pulling the strip in contactwith the stationary cylinder (roll
20、er) is continuously measuredand recorded. The static and kinetic coefficients of friction arecalculated from the force measured by the force transducer.5. Significance and Use5.1 This test method is intended to simulate the slip of aflexible web on a roller in a machine or tribosystem thatconveys we
21、b materials. Flexible webs such as plastic sheeting,paper, elastomers, metal foils, and cloth are often transported inmanufacturing processes by combinations of driving and idlerrollers. The friction characteristics of the web/roller interfaceoften affects the web transport process. If the web/rolle
22、rfriction is too low, the web can slip on the rollers and bedamaged or damage the roller. High friction on the other hand,can lead to steering problems and overloading of drivingmotors.5.2 This test method can be used to rank rollers for theirability to resist slip versus a particular web material (
23、highfriction). Conversely this test method can assess web materialsor web surface coatings such as waxes and lubricants. In thislatter case, the goal may be a low-friction product made froma web (film, magnetic media, paper, and so forth).5.3 If a tribosystem involves transport of a flexible web ona
